Jeffreys Bay is considered the surfing jewel of the Eastern Cape. Rated among the ten best surfing spots in the world, Jeffreys Bay, or 'J-Bay' as it's known to the locals, hosts the Billabong Surfing Festival every July, which attracts top surfers from around the world to ride the infamous Supertubes. Jeffreys Bay is a paradise of classic reefs, sunshine and dolphins, and visitors who find it hard to leave such an idyllic spot have turned J Bay into a year-round fun place to be, creating a thriving local craft industry besides the surf shops on just about every corner.
Jeffreys Bay is a small bustling town, making the beachfront accommodation, internet cafes, shops and of course surf shops all within easy walking distance. Things to do and see in Jeffreys Bay, Eastern Cape:
Potter's Place - Indulge your taste-buds, take a pottery lesson, browse the gift shop, or watch a seasonal live show.
J Bay Happy Hippo Play Farm - let the kids feed the farm animals and play.
Fountains Mall - shop till you drop while the kids are occupied at Funky Frogs Play Centre.
Jeffreys Bay Surf Museum - see why J-Bay has been one of the top surfing spots in the world for the last 50 years.
J Bay Impala Ranch MTB Trails - a fun, fast paced 18km loop through forests and valleys.
Jeffreys Bay Golf Club - 9 hole course situated 70m above sea level with a beautiful view over the ocean.
Dolphin Beach Entertainment Centre - famous for its 18 hole Putt Putt Course and heated waterslide.
Kabeljous Nature Reserve - hike through dune thickets, forests, bushveld and wetlands.
